Contrary to popular belief, there is no provision or entitlement to four hours payment  (suitably enhanced) for receiving a telephone call at home.

If, however, a call is received and as a result of that call you are required or instructed to go somewhere, or perform duty, then the view is that this may well be a recall to duty and be eligible for the appropriate amount of compensation.

Answering the telephone does not constitute a recall to duty.
